I always found it an interesting choice that they changed mjolnir so much in this anime
For those of you who dont know, in actually mythology Mjolnir has a defect, that being that the handle was too small
Then in this anime they were just like "lets make the hammer the size of a building"

Fun fact: In the actual mythology, Thor uses two metal gauntlets to help him wield Mjolnir, as well as a belt that doubles his strength. He uses these to enhance his power, not to restrain it. It also goes without saying that Mjolnir is much smaller in the actual mythology, more closely resembling the God of War version or the ones on necklaces.
